Mr. Kevin Lamont Stephens

March 17, 1986 ~ July 4, 2015 (age 29) 29 Years Old


     Mr. Kevin Lamont Stephens, 29 of Lumberton passed away July 4, 2015. Celebration of Life services will be Saturday, July 11, 2015 at 11:00 AM at First Baptist Church in Lumberton. Burial willl follow at Elizabeth Heights Cemetery in Lumberton. Visitation is Friday July 10, 2015 from 3-6 PM at Worley Mortuary & Cremation Service of Lumberton.

     Mr. Kevin Lamont Stephens, was born on March 17, 1986 in Lumberton, NC to Mr. Jeffery Ray Stephens and the late Ms. Gloria Ann Bethea. Kevin enjoyed life to the fullest. He always kept a big smile on his handsome face, for all who know “Kelbo”, you know he had the biggest gap and he wasn’t ashamed to show it. Kevin embraced and loved everyone he came in contact with. He would always say that family was everything to him, because that’s all he had to live for. Kevin “Kelbo” will be truly missed.
